American National University-Lexington
American National University-Lexington is one of the fifteen private, for-profit 4-year colleges in Kentucky. The campus is located in an urban area, in Lexington.
According to the NCES 2017 report, a total of 233 students attend the school. Every year 40% of the graduating class students graduate in 150% of the time it takes to complete their studies.American National University-Lexington's in-state tuition for the 2017-2018 academic year was $14,832, and fees were $54. Out-of-state tuition and fees for the same period were $14,832 and $54 respectively.

If you attend a private, for-profit school, usually the additional cost (besides tuition) is about 10% of the tuition. If you attend a public school or a not-for-profit private school, the additional cost is around 50% of the tuition.
